c语言编程笔录

首页 >   > 笔记大全

笔记大全

html背景图片如何设置大小

更新时间:2023-08-13

问题介绍:

在网页设计中,背景图片的大小设置是一个常见的需求。通过控制背景图片的大小,我们可以让页面的布局更加灵活和美观。在HTML中,可以使用CSS来设置背景图片的大小。下面将介绍具体的方法和代码。

方法一:使用background-size属性

background-size属性是CSS3提供的用于控制背景图片大小的属性。通过设置该属性的值,我们可以指定背景图片的尺寸。这个属性可以使用以下几种常见的值:

body {
  background-image: url("background.jpg");
  background-size: 100% 100%;
}

上述代码的background-size属性将背景图片的宽度和高度都设置为100%,这样背景图片将会自动缩放以适应屏幕大小。

方法二:使用background-attachment属性

如果你希望保持背景图片的原始尺寸,并且背景图片随着页面内容的滚动而滚动,可以使用background-attachment属性。该属性有两个可选值:fixed和scroll。fixed表示背景图片固定,不随滚动而移动;scroll表示背景图片随滚动而移动。

body {
  background-image: url("background.jpg");
  background-attachment: fixed;
}

上述代码会将背景图片固定在网页的可视区域,不会随着页面的滚动而改变位置。

总结:

通过使用background-size和background-attachment属性,我们可以轻松地设置背景图片的大小和样式。根据实际需求,选择不同的属性值可以达到不同的效果。在进行网页设计时,灵活运用这些属性可以使页面更加美观和吸引人。